How to Get Thailand Tourist e-visa from Kathmandu for Nepali Citizen by Online?
How to Apply Thai Visa from Kathmandu? Nepali Citizen and foreigners so easy in 2025. This Thailand Visa for Nepali is effective from May 01st 2025
Starting from May 1st, all foreign nationals traveling to Thailand must register for the digital TM.6 form, known as the Thailand Digital Arrival Card (TDAC), at least 3 days prior to their arrival.
The Immigration Bureau of Thailand is launching a new system for the registration of foreign nationals entering or leaving the Kingdom, known as the Thailand Digital Arrival Card (TDAC). All foreign nationals entering Thailand are required to register through this online system.
This system applies to travelers arriving via all channels — land, sea, and air — and registration must be completed online via the website http://tdac.immigration.go.th. An application will also be available in the near future.
Foreign travelers can complete the TDAC registration up to 3 days before entering Thailand. Required information includes travel documents, passport details, personal information, travel plans, accommodation in Thailand, and health status according to announcements by the Ministry of Public Health.
Please note that the TDAC is not a visa. It is an online arrival card system developed to facilitate travel and align with international regulations and requirements.
1. Visit www.tdac.immigration.go.th or scan the provided QR code.
2. Complete the personal and travel information form.
3. Submit the form and receive a confirmation email.
4. Present the confirmation along with travel documents to immigration officers upon arrival in Thailand.
Additionally, the website www.tdac.immigration.go.th provides user-friendly resources in five languages: English, Chinese, Korean, Russian, and Japanese. Pamphlets and instructional video clips are also available to assist travelers with the registration process.
The Immigration Bureau has coordinated with related agencies such as the Ministry of Foreign Affairs’ e-Visa system, the Disease Control Department’s health screening system, and the Ministry of Tourism and Sports’ tourist fee collection system. This collaborative effort aims to ensure a seamless and efficient entry process into Thailand.
Applicants for Tourist (TR and TR-MT), Transit (TS and S) and Non-Immigrant (B / IB, ED, F, M, O, O-A, O-X and R) Visa categories are requested to submit required documents for the application through official Thai E-Visa Online (THAI E-VISA OFFICIAL WEBSITE ) Ministry of Foreign Affairs of the Kingdom of Thailand
Further information, please contact
Website: https://www.thaievisa.go.th/video-user-manuals
Create your account by online
Fill in an Visa Application form with details
Upload Support Documents
Pay visa fee through any of Global IME bank branch
Wait for the Visa to be Processed
E-Visa conformation sent by email to print or download
All applications are subject to approval and the Royal Thai Embassy or Consulate-General may request for an interview or additional documents. Submission of a visa application does not necessarily mean that a visa will be granted. Please also note that the visa fees are non-refundable.
Citizen of Nepal who wish to travel and visit to Royal Thailand are required for a Visa either traveling by air or land or from overseas. Following documentation required for visa processing by online.
167/4 Ward No. 3, Maharajgunj, Bansbari Road
PO Box 3333
Tel: (977 1) 4371410, 4371411
Fax: (977 1) 4371408, 4371409
E-mail: thaiembassy.ktm@mfa.mail.go.th
Thai Embassy Tourist Visa Section